The OpenSSH 8.8 is now in the stable channel of Arch Linux and could reach other distributions any time soon.
In the release 8.7, the OpenSSH team announced that the ssh-rsa signature scheme will be disabled by default in the next version: 8.8.
Why?
The ssh-rsa signature scheme uses SHA-1 and it's sensible to chosen-prefix attacks.
What should I do?
This should not be a problem unless you are connecting to a server using the weak ssh-rsa public key algorithm for host authentication.
💡 If you're using the version 8.7 or a previous one, you can test your remote hosts like a GitLab or a cloud server using:
ssh -oHostKeyAlgorithms=-ssh-rsa user@host

If the connection fails, that means that the signature algorithm is not compatible with the default configuration of OpenSSH 8.8.
Enabling the weak signature
If you can't upgrade the signature algorithm on your remote servers but you still need to use them, you can use the following command:
ssh -oHostKeyAlgorithms=+ssh-rsa user@host

Using the weak signature with Git
Right now, Bitbucket uses this weak signature algorithm, I guess you need to use your Git repositories
hosted there. 🥺 You can check your connection with the following command:
ssh -oHostKeyAlgorithms=+ssh-rsa

How can we enable this flag for all the Git commands? An easy solution is coming... You can create an SSH configuration file with the following content:
Host bitbucket.org HostKeyAlgorithms +ssh-rsa IdentitiesOnly yes

The default location of this file is under ~/.ssh/config, maybe you already have one. Once you add this configuration value you can use any git command without restrictions.

The version of OpenSSH included in 16.04 disables ssh-dss. There's a neat page with legacy information that includes this issue: //www.openssh.com/legacy.html
In a nutshell, you should add the option -oHostKeyAlgorithms=+ssh-dss to the SSH command:
ssh -oHostKeyAlgorithms=+ssh-dssYou can also add a host pattern in your ~/.ssh/config so you don't have to specify the key algorithm every time:
Host nas HostName 192.168.8.109 HostKeyAlgorithms=+ssh-dssThis has the added benefit that you don't need to type out the IP address. Instead, ssh will recognize the host nas and know where to connect to. Of course you can use any other name in its stead.

If you came here because Bitbucket returns the following after an update to OpenSSH 8.8:
Unable to negotiate with <ip address> port 22: no matching host key type found. Their offer: ssh-rsa,ssh-dssyou should NOT enable DSS (like in the accepted answer), but rather RSA in ~/.ssh/config:
Host bitbucket.org HostKeyAlgorithms +ssh-rsa PubkeyAcceptedKeyTypes +ssh-rsaReference: //community.atlassian.com/t5/Bitbucket-articles/OpenSSH-8-8-client-incompatibility-and-workaround/ba-p/1826047
Note that PubkeyAcceptedKeyTypes is a backwards compatible alias to PubkeyAcceptedAlgorithms which has been suggested in the article. If you use it, the same configuration can be used with older OpenSSH client versions, e.g. if you share the config with docker containers.
You can do the same for other hosts, or use Host * to allow RSA for any host.

If you want to use newer OpenSSH to connect to deprecated servers:
ssh -o KexAlgorithms=diffie-hellman-group14-sha1 -oHostKeyAlgorithms=+ssh-dss my.host.comAdd -v if you want to see what's happening, and -o HostKeyAlgorithms=ssh-dss if it still doesn't work:
ssh -v -o HostKeyAlgorithms=ssh-dss -o KexAlgorithms=diffie-hellman-group14-sha1 my.host.comYou can also edit /etc/ssh/ssh_config or ~/.ssh/ssh_config and add:
Host my.host.com *.myinsecure.net 192.168.1.* 192.168.2.* HostKeyAlgorithms ssh-dss KexAlgorithms diffie-hellman-group1-sha1//forum.ctwug.za.net/t/fyi-openssh-to-access-rbs-openssh-7/6069 mentions the following fix on Mikrotik Routerboards:
/ip ssh set strong-crypto=yes(Noting this here because this answer also comes up on web searches when looking for a similar error message.)

The 'their offer' list of algorithms are the ones that the server will accept so the client needs to offer matching ones. As mentioned one way to fix this is add the missing algorithms to your .ssh/config file. If it still doesn't work it is worth checking which algorithms your version of ssh has to offer:
ssh -Q keyIf you do not see the missing algorithm listed from this command then you will need update your ssh version.
But if you do see the missing algorithm there then it's possible that either the system /etc/ssh/ssh_config file and/or /Users/USERNAME/.ssh/config contains a HostkeyAlgorithms line that limits the number of algorithms. This can happen if the algorithms are listed without + prefix which will then lead to ssh only offering those on that list e.g. (HostkeyAlgorithms ssh-dsa) so this can be fixed by just commenting that line, or explicitly adding the specific missing algorithms. The + prefix will add one or more algorithms to the list.
